For the 2025-26 school year, there is 1 public high school serving 199 students in Weimar Independent School District. This district's average high testing ranking is 6/10, which is in the top 50% of public high schools in Texas.
Public High School in Weimar Independent School District have an average math proficiency score of 55% (versus the Texas public high school average of 38%), and reading proficiency score of 42% (versus the 47% statewide average).
Public High School in Weimar Independent School District have a Graduation Rate of 90%, which is equal to the Texas average of 90%.
The school with highest graduation rate is Weimar High School, with ≥90% graduation rate. Read more about public school graduation rate statistics in Texas or national school graduation rate statistics.
Minority enrollment is 57%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Texas public high school average of 74% (majority Hispanic).

District Revenue and Spending

The revenue/student of $14,539 is higher than the state median of $13,398. The school district revenue/student has declined by 7%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$20,370 is higher than the state median of $14,129. The school district spending/student has declined by 7% over four school years.
